Sun Tzu‘s fightless victory is like the Platonic pearl, ideal, perfectly spherical. Pep‘s blowless round is like a cut diamond, multifaceted — some claim the tale is true, some that he fabricated the tale years later, some that it was a boast he made before the fight — one version suggests Pep told St. Paul sports writer Don Riley, who was covering the fight for Minnesota radio station WMIN:

Pick a round, I’ll throw punches, but I’ll never hit him. Check the scorecards after, and see if the judges fall for it.

Who knows? A good tale frays into a thousand fugal strands in the Ocean of Story.
